From Chris Stevenson via the Toronto Sun:
He’s gone 14 games now since scoring his last goal.
It’s a bit of a story that the Bruins could be tied in the series with nothing from their big gun.
“We’ve won the last two games and in the playoffs, the only thing that matters is wins and losses,” said Lucic. “I’m not happy with the way I’m playing and I know I can bring a lot more. For now, I have to stop thinking negatively about what I’ve done wrong and think about what I can do right.
“I’ve always put pressure on myself and never had a problem dealing with pressure in the playoffs. I’ve just got to go out there and bring what I can bring.”
In Montreal, the questions all surround Carey Price: “It’s Price vs. Thomas. Best of three. Could we ask for a better end to this series?”
